admin 管理员组文章数量: 887186
2024年2月18日发(作者:如何用excel产生随机数)
c语言4行4列二维数组,求四周元素之和
在c语言中,二维数组是一个重要的数据类型,它可以方便地存储多维数据,如矩阵、表格等数据。如果需要对二维数组进行相关操作,可以使用循环语句来实现。本文将围绕“c语言4行4列二维数组,求四周元素之和”这一问题,分步骤进行介绍。
第一步:定义二维数组
在c语言中,可以使用以下语句来定义一个4行4列的二维数组:
int a[4][4];
这段代码定义了一个名为a的二维数组,它有4行和4列,共16个元素。每个元素的类型为int,即整数类型。
第二步:初始化二维数组
在使用二维数组之前,需要先对其进行初始化,即为其赋初值。可以使用以下语句来初始化二维数组:
int a[4][4] = {
{1, 2, 3, 4},
{5, 6, 7, 8},
{9, 10, 11, 12},
{13, 14, 15, 16}
};
这段代码将二维数组a初始化为一个4行4列的矩阵,其中第一行的元素为1、2、3、4,第二行的元素为5、6、7、8,以此类推。
第三步:计算四周元素之和
要计算四周元素之和,需要遍历二维数组,并查找每个元素的四周元素。可以使用两层循环语句来遍历二维数组,如下所示:
int sum = 0;
for (int i = 0; i < 4; i++) {
for (int j = 0; j < 4; j++) {
if (i == 0 || i == 3 || j == 0 || j == 3) {
sum += a[i][j];
}
}
}
这段代码会遍历整个二维数组,并判断每个元素是否位于四周,并累加其值到sum变量中。具体地,当i等于0或3,或j等于0或3时,表示该元素位于四周,需要累加其值。
第四步:输出结果
最后,可以使用以下语句来输出四周元素之和的结果:
printf("四周元素之和为:%dn", sum);
这段代码会将四周元素之和输出到控制台上,以便查看。
总结
通过以上介绍,可以看出,在c语言中,要计算二维数组的四周元素之和,需要进行四步操作:定义二维数组、初始化二维数组、计算四周元素之和、输出结果。以上代码供参考,需要根据实际情况进行修改和调整。
版权声明:本文标题:c语言4行4列二维数组,求四周元素之和 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/free/1708261073h517873.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论